NETMAP 路由转发

  • external_host 对外提供访问的外网ip端口信息,如果不需要对外提供访问,设置成和listen_host一样
  • listen_host 实际进行监听的内网机器的ip端口信息
  • target_host 转发到的目标主机ip端口信息

主要分为两部分连接,1、获取TOPIC所在的KFFKA信息,2 根据返回的TOPIC所在的主机,访问适当的TOPIC信息

  • 访问KAFKA,需要两个连接

    • 连接一:访问指定访问指定目标的KAFKA信息,获取指定TOPIC所在的KAFKA节点
    • 连接二:根据返回节点再次访问TOPIC所在主机的TOPIC数据.
  • 数据访问方式
    Client -> 202.102.101.203 -> 192.168.0.4 ->KAFKAIP【192.168.0.101/192.168.0.102,192.169.0.103】

    Client -> 根据返回的地址进行数据获取服务。在第一返回的数据包过程中,NetMap对软件数据进行一次加密和映射任务,返回直接需要获取数据的外网LINK服务。

  • 连接信息返回层
    返回TOPIC所在的服务器连接地址和端口等信息
  • 数据信息返回层
    返回TOPIC所在的
  • 根据返回IP地址,获取指定kafka节点基础信息,根据基础信息获取TOPIC数据信息
文档更新时间: 2022-10-24 21:41   作者:阿力